What are the laws that address the crime of tax evasion in Guatemala?
In Guatemala, the crime of tax evasion is regulated in the Penal Code and the Tax Update Law. These laws establish sanctions for those who evade or evade the payment of taxes through fraudulent practices or the concealment of income or assets. The legislation seeks to guarantee equity and transparency in the tax system, promoting compliance with tax obligations.
What is the procedure to request compensatory pension in case of divorce in Honduras?
The procedure to request compensatory pension in case of divorce in Honduras involves filing a lawsuit before the family judge. Evidence must be provided of the need for the alimony and the financial ability of the other spouse to pay it. The judge will evaluate the case and determine the fair and equitable amount of alimony, considering the individual circumstances of each spouse.

Can I obtain my judicial records in Costa Rica if I live abroad?
Yes, if you live abroad, you can still obtain your judicial records in Costa Rica. You can apply through the Costa Rican Embassy or Consulate in the country where you are located, or use online services that offer access to these records. Additional documentation may be required to verify your identity and properly process your request.
